Default 69 rear axle sits too far towards driver side

HI All,

I have been trying to solve why my rear tire scrapes on inner fender lip on one side. It's on a mostly stock 69 GTO with 255/60/15 tires scrapes over deep dips only on drivers side. It has been shaving rubber off the sidewall and probably time to change the tires because of this.

I had replaced all the control arm bushing w polygraphite 20 years ago and everything looks good there. Axle seems to sit about 1/2 inch more towards the driver side of the car. Pass side has the clearance. The driver side also sat 1 inch lower but I adjusted that even with Spohn SP1 coilovers and adjustable shocks set to stiffness of what is tolerable but it still scrapes.

Car has boxed lower control arms with factory sway bar.

Any thoughts on how to balance out the rear axle so it sits evenly?
